Folktale
Discover the rich tapestry of storytelling in "Folktale," a fascinating exploration by the University of California Press. Published in 1978, this comprehensive paperback spans 524 pages, delving into a wide range of story motifs and their fundamental patterns. The author shares insights into the background of his own study of folktales, offering readers a deeper understanding of these timeless narratives. This essential resource also features an index of tale types, meticulously classified according to the main story motifs, making it an invaluable reference for scholars, students, and anyone interested in the art of storytelling.
